HUB hero image

How to Travel from

Hilton Diagonal Mar Barcelona to La Roca Village

by Rideshare, Route or Car

Hilton Diagonal Mar Barcelona
+0
La Roca Village
Transport search to La Roca Village
Hilton Diagonal Mar Barcelona
+0
La Roca Village
Building a composite car route
Cheapest
Best Offer!
Car
23 min
32 km.
from $1
Composite Route Car Only

Three ways to Travel from Hilton Diagonal Mar Barcelona to La Roca Village

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Bus operators

Sagales

Phone:
+34 93 593 13 00
Website:
sagales.com/es
Bus from Barcelona, Estació d'Autobusos Nord to Centro
Ave. Duration:
35 min
Frequency:
Every 2 hours
Estimated price:
$6.33–$15.19
Bus from Cardedeu to Centro
Ave. Duration:
10 min
Frequency:
Every 3 hours
Estimated price:
$1.52–$2.15

Àrea Metropolitana de Barcelona

Website:
amb.cat/en/web/guest/home
Bus from Diagonal - Josep Pla to Almogàvers
Ave. Duration:
13 min
Frequency:
Every 10 minutes

Train operators

Rodalies de Catalunya

Phone:
+34 900 41 00 41
Website:
rodalies.gencat.cat/es/inici/index.html
Train from Estación de tren Barcelona-El Clot to Estación
Ave. Duration:
36 min
Frequency:
Hourly
Estimated price:
$3.67–$5.19

TRAM

Phone:
+34 900 701 181
Website:
tram.cat/
Train from El Maresme to Glòries
Ave. Duration:
9 min
Frequency:
Every 10 minutes
Estimated price:
$2.48

Questions and Answers

What is the cheapest way to get from Hilton Diagonal Mar Barcelona to La Roca Village?

The cheapest way to get from Hilton Diagonal Mar Barcelona to La Roca Village is to drive which costs $5.43 - $8.70 and takes 24 min.

What is the fastest way to get from Hilton Diagonal Mar Barcelona to La Roca Village?

The fastest way to get from Hilton Diagonal Mar Barcelona to La Roca Village is to drive which takes 24 min and costs $5.43 - $8.70 .

Is there a direct bus between Hilton Diagonal Mar Barcelona and La Roca Village?

No, there is no direct bus from Hilton Diagonal Mar Barcelona to La Roca Village. However, there are services departing from Diagonal - Josep Pla and arriving at Centro Comercial via Barcelona, Estació d'Autobusos Nord. The journey, including transfers, takes approximately 1h 53m.

How far is it from Hilton Diagonal Mar Barcelona to La Roca Village?

The distance between Hilton Diagonal Mar Barcelona and La Roca Village is 40 km. The road distance is 32.7 km.

How do I travel from Hilton Diagonal Mar Barcelona to La Roca Village without a car?

The best way to get from Hilton Diagonal Mar Barcelona to La Roca Village without a car is to bus and line 405 bus which takes 1h 53m and costs .

How long does it take to get from Hilton Diagonal Mar Barcelona to La Roca Village?

It takes approximately 1h 53m to get from Hilton Diagonal Mar Barcelona to La Roca Village, including transfers.

Where do I catch the Hilton Diagonal Mar Barcelona to La Roca Village bus from?

Hilton Diagonal Mar Barcelona to La Roca Village bus services, operated by Àrea Metropolitana de Barcelona, depart from Diagonal - Josep Pla station.

Where does the Hilton Diagonal Mar Barcelona to La Roca Village bus arrive?

Hilton Diagonal Mar Barcelona to La Roca Village bus services, operated by Àrea Metropolitana de Barcelona, arrive at Almogàvers - Marina station.

Can I drive from Hilton Diagonal Mar Barcelona to La Roca Village?

Yes, the driving distance between Hilton Diagonal Mar Barcelona to La Roca Village is 33 km. It takes approximately 24 min to drive from Hilton Diagonal Mar Barcelona to La Roca Village.

Where can I stay near La Roca Village?

There are 916+ hotels available in La Roca Village. Prices start at $47.72 per night.
+0